What Role Do Data Representations Play in Enhancing Critical Thinking Skills in Year 8?

Data representations are important for helping Year 8 students think critically in Mathematics, especially when handling data. By looking at different types of visuals, students build important skills that help them make smart decisions based on what they see.

Different Types of Data Representations:

  1. Pictograms:

    • These use pictures or symbols to show data.
    • They make it easier to understand information.
    • For example, if 1 picture equals 5 items, it helps show total counts quickly.
  2. Bar Charts:

    • These use bars to show different categories.
    • They are great for comparing groups.
    • For example, a survey might find that 30% of students like basketball, while 20% prefer football.
  3. Histograms:

    • These show continuous data in ranges.
    • They help us see trends and patterns.
    • For instance, a histogram of test scores can show that most students score between 60 and 70.
  4. Line Graphs:

    • These show changes in data over time.
    • They are good for spotting trends.
    • For example, a line graph might show the temperature going from 15°C to 25°C in one week.

Enhancing Critical Thinking:

  • Data Interpretation: Students learn how to make sense of important information, helping them reach conclusions. For instance, using a bar chart to find the most popular sport can spark discussions about how active students are.

  • Problem-Solving Skills: Looking at data visually encourages students to tackle tough problems. They can guess why certain trends show up in line graphs or histograms.

  • Statistical Literacy: Learning about data representation helps students understand statistics, making them better at checking information. Studies show that being good with data can improve decision-making skills by up to 35%.

In conclusion, data representations not only make math easier to understand but also help Year 8 students build important critical thinking skills. These skills are essential for both school and life outside the classroom.
